Three Americans Advance To Finals In Speed World Championships

The Speed World Championships began early this morning in Moscow, Russia. Emma Hunt, John Brosler, and Noah Bratschi, all from the US, qualified for finals in third, forth, and sixth place, respectively. Find the finalists below.
